Search jobs now Find the right job type for you Create a job alert Explore how we help job seekers Contract talent Permanent talent Learn how we work with you Executive search Finance and Accounting Technology Marketing and Creative Legal Administrative and Customer Support Technology Risk, Audit and Compliance Finance and Accounting Digital, Marketing and Customer Experience Legal Operations Human Resources 2026 Salary Guide Demand for Skilled Talent Report Job Market Outlook Press Room Tech insights Labor market overview AI in recruiting Navigating the AI era Staffing for small businesses Cost of a bad hire Browse jobs Find your next hire Our locations

Add your latest resume to match with open positions.

6 results for E Commerce Developer in Madison, WI

Full Stack Developer
  • Middleton, WI
  • remote
  • Temporary / Contract
  • 57 - 66 USD / Hourly
  • <p>We are partnering with a technology-driven organization seeking a Full Stack Developer to support enterprise application modernization, API development, and cloud-based solutions. This role will focus on designing, developing, and enhancing scalable web applications while collaborating across engineering teams in a highly technical and evolving environment.</p><p>This opportunity is ideal for someone who enjoys solving complex problems, modernizing systems, improving development practices, and contributing to architecture and delivery decisions. The team values experimentation, continuous improvement, collaboration, and strong engineering fundamentals.</p><p>What You’ll Be Doing</p><ul><li>Design, develop, modernize, and support full-stack web applications</li><li>Build scalable backend services and REST APIs</li><li>Develop responsive frontend user interfaces and reusable components</li><li>Participate in modernization efforts involving legacy frameworks and enterprise systems</li><li>Support integrations with internal and external systems</li><li>Contribute to architectural decisions, deployment strategies, and performance improvements</li><li>Troubleshoot issues across enterprise application environments from infrastructure through application layers</li><li>Participate in code reviews, testing initiatives, Agile ceremonies, and continuous improvement efforts</li><li>Mentor and guide team members on development best practices and modern engineering approaches</li></ul><p><br></p>
  • 2026-06-05T00:00:00Z
ERP/CRM Developer
  • Whitewater, WI
  • remote
  • Temporary / Contract
  • 95 - 110 USD / Hourly
  • We are looking for an ERP/CRM Developer to support a higher education organization in Whitewater, Wisconsin with a PeopleSoft Student Financials tuition implementation. This Long-term Contract position focuses on building and enhancing technical solutions that support tuition assessment, student billing, and financial accuracy throughout the student lifecycle. The role will work closely with business and technology stakeholders to deliver configuration, development, integration, and testing support for a successful module rollout.<br><br>Responsibilities:<br>• Develop and maintain PeopleSoft Student Financials solutions with a focus on tuition processing and related billing functions.<br>• Configure tuition calculation logic to align with academic terms, residency status, credit loads, and institutional fee structures.<br>• Create and enhance technical components using PeopleCode, Application Engine, and other PeopleSoft development tools to meet project needs.<br>• Collaborate with functional partners to convert business objectives into reliable technical designs and system enhancements.<br>• Support data conversion efforts, test execution, issue analysis, and resolution of defects during implementation activities.<br>• Build and maintain integrations between PeopleSoft and connected external platforms, including payment and campus-related systems.<br>• Monitor system performance and data quality to improve the reliability of tuition and billing operations.<br>• Prepare technical documentation and provide knowledge transfer to internal teams following implementation milestones.
  • 2026-06-11T00:00:00Z
Django Developer
  • Middleton, WI
  • remote
  • Temporary / Contract
  • 57 - 66 USD / Hourly
  • <p>We are partnering with a technology-focused organization seeking a Django Full Stack Developer to support modernization and enhancement efforts for a large-scale web application environment. This role will focus on upgrading and modernizing existing Django applications while contributing to backend services, frontend UI development, and integrations across enterprise systems.</p><p>This opportunity is ideal for someone who enjoys solving complex technical challenges, modernizing legacy applications, improving engineering practices, and collaborating closely with cross-functional teams. The environment values continuous improvement, experimentation, mentorship, and delivery excellence.</p><p>What You’ll Be Doing</p><ul><li>Design, develop, and modernize Django-based web applications</li><li>Upgrade legacy Django applications to current LTS versions</li><li>Build and support backend services and REST API integrations</li><li>Develop and enhance frontend user interfaces using modern web technologies</li><li>Collaborate on application architecture, scalability, and modernization strategies</li><li>Support integrations with internal enterprise systems and data platforms</li><li>Participate in code reviews, troubleshooting, testing, and deployment activities</li><li>Mentor and guide team members on development standards and best practices</li><li>Contribute to a culture focused on continuous improvement and technical excellence</li></ul><p><br></p>
  • 2026-06-05T00:00:00Z
Django Developer
  • Middleton, WI
  • remote
  • Temporary / Contract
  • 68.4 - 79.2 USD / Hourly
  • <p>We are partnering with an organization that is investing heavily in modernizing and enhancing its digital platforms and is looking to add a Senior Angular Developer to a collaborative, Agile delivery team. This individual will play a key role in designing, developing, and modernizing a large-scale Angular web application while helping shape technical direction and engineering best practices.</p><p>This is an opportunity to join a highly collaborative environment where innovation, continuous improvement, and mentorship are valued.</p><p>What You’ll Be Doing</p><ul><li>Design, develop, and modernize Angular-based web applications</li><li>Build rich, responsive user interfaces using Angular and TypeScript</li><li>Develop and integrate RESTful APIs and backend services</li><li>Collaborate with cross-functional teams including product, QA, and engineering</li><li>Help drive architectural decisions and modern development practices</li><li>Upgrade and modernize legacy Angular applications to current LTS versions</li><li>Perform code reviews and provide mentorship to junior and mid-level developers</li><li>Promote a culture of continuous improvement, experimentation, and knowledge sharing</li><li>Identify opportunities for process improvements, tooling enhancements, and innovation</li><li>Participate in Agile ceremonies and contribute throughout the software development lifecycle</li></ul><p><br></p>
  • 2026-06-05T00:00:00Z
Android Mobile Developer
  • Middleton, WI
  • remote
  • Temporary / Contract
  • 57 - 66 USD / Hourly
  • <p>We’re partnering with a growing technology team that is kicking off a major mobile modernization initiative in June and is looking to add a Senior Android Mobile Developer to the project team.</p><p>This role is ideal for someone who enjoys building modern mobile applications, mentoring other developers, and helping shape technical direction within a collaborative engineering environment. You’ll work closely with cross-functional teams to modernize a native Android application while contributing across backend services, frontend mobile interfaces, and integrations with internal systems.</p><p>What You’ll Be Doing</p><ul><li>Design, develop, and modernize a native Android mobile application</li><li>Collaborate with product owners, developers, QA, and business stakeholders to deliver scalable technical solutions</li><li>Support modernization efforts from legacy Java-based Android applications to Kotlin</li><li>Build and maintain REST APIs and integrations with internal systems</li><li>Participate in architecture discussions and contribute to long-term technical strategy</li><li>Perform code reviews and provide mentorship to junior and mid-level engineers</li><li>Promote best practices, innovation, and continuous improvement within the development team</li><li>Evaluate and test new tools, frameworks, and approaches to improve delivery and application performance</li><li>Build strong partnerships with business stakeholders and take ownership of business outcomes</li></ul><p><br></p>
  • 2026-05-29T00:00:00Z
Software Engineer
  • Madison, WI
  • onsite
  • Permanent / Full Time
  • 120000 - 165000 USD / Yearly
  • <p>Robert Half is seeking a Senior Software Engineer to join a highly technical product development team based in Madison, WI. The role will focus on building advanced desktop applications used for complex 3D data visualization, reconstruction, and analysis. This role is ideal for an engineer who enjoys solving difficult technical problems, working closely with hardware and data-intensive systems, and contributing to software used in real-world scientific and engineering environments.</p><p><br></p><p>This is a hands-on engineering role with strong influence over architecture, performance optimization, and technical direction. The position offers a mix of new development, modernization efforts, and collaboration with cross-functional engineering teams.</p><p><br></p><ul><li><strong>Direct/Permanent Hire Role</strong></li><li><strong>Hybrid work schedule in Madison, WI is expected</strong></li><li><strong>Relocation assistance offered for highly qualified candidates</strong></li><li><strong>Sponsorship is not available</strong></li><li><strong>This role is not eligible for Corp-to-Corp </strong></li></ul><p><strong>What You’ll Do:</strong></p><ul><li>Design and develop Windows desktop applications for complex data analysis and visualization</li><li>Build and optimize software that processes large-scale 3D datasets</li><li>Improve application performance, scalability, multithreading, and memory efficiency</li><li>Contribute to architecture decisions and technical direction for core software components</li><li>Develop analytical and visualization tools for highly technical end users</li><li>Modernize and refactor existing applications and legacy codebases</li><li>Troubleshoot software and system-level technical issues</li><li>Collaborate with engineering, product, service, and technical stakeholders</li><li>Mentor other engineers and provide technical guidance when needed</li><li>Participate in code reviews, design discussions, and Agile development activities</li></ul><p><br></p>
  • 2026-05-19T00:00:00Z